LeBron James and the Los Angeles Lakers will have their hands full over the next few weeks. With Anthony Davis sidelined due to an injury, the Lakers’ supporting cast needs to step up in his place.

Tonight, the purple and gold faced off against the Minnesota Timberwolves. The game ended in a 112-14 victory for the LA Lakers as LeBron James had yet another stunning game. LBJ finished the fixture with 30 points and 13 rebounds while shooting 13-of-20 from the field.

Needless to say, the purple and gold are in fine form and they adjusted pretty well to fill in the wide gap left by Anthony Davis. But can the reigning champions maintain this form for their upcoming games as well?

Lakers’ Marc Gasol on LeBron James’ leadership

In the post-game interview, Lakers center Marc Gasol shared his thoughts on the recipe for success for his team in the absence of AD. Gasol said, “It’s important to grow as a team. I think defensively, we had a little bit more urgency. You don’t have AD on the back, kind of saving a lot of possessions… So we set the tone, we were winding up the ball, we were able to get out and run a little bit and get easy transition points.”

USA Today via Reuters

Gasol further talked about LeBron stepping up and shouldering a larger burden in the absence of Davis. Gasol said, “He does it all, very unselfish, great mind, has all the tools. Happy he’s on my team or I’m on his team [laughs].”

As Gasol mentioned earlier, LeBron is one of the most complete players the league has ever seen. He is excellent on both ends of the floor and can switch gears whenever required. Tonight, fans witnessed his capabilities as a leader, even at the age of 36.
